Logo
Towing service
Unclaimed
Anchor Towing And Transport
logo
Anchor Towing And Transport
00 Likes
media-photo
media-photo
Primary Location
Main location23490 CA-18 Apple Valley California 92307 US
Loading...
Loading...
Home
Businesses
Marketplace